Norwegian-Iranian Amanda Delara Receives Triple Nominations For The Norwegian Grammy Award

Norwegian-Iranian singer Amanda Delara has received significant recognition in the Norwegian music scene, being nominated for three Norwegian Grammys in the categories of pop, release of the year and lyricist of the year. The Norwegian Grammy Award is known as the most important music award in Norway, which marks Delara’s remarkable achievement in the Norwegian music scene. 

Born to Iranian parents, Amanda Delara uses her multicultural heritage in her music, a fusion vividly reflected in her debut album, “Shahrazad”, where she showcases her Persian cultural influences. Delara’s artistic journey has been marked by milestones, including a sold-out tour in Norway, further underscoring her position as a rising star in the Norwegian music landscape.
